Climate

Worksheet overview

Description:

A map of the world's climate is presented based on the map's captions: TROPICAL: high temperature, regular, rainy season. DRY: low rainfall, high temperatures during the day. WARM: temperate climates such as ours with 4 seasons.

Teaching orientation:

General Objectives: To acquire practical learning skills, and to transfer communication strategies and knowledge to other languages. To use this language progressively as a medium for learning content for the topic. To identify phonetic aspects, rhythm, stress and intonation, together with linguistic structures and lexical aspects of the foreign language, and to use these as basic communication resources. Specific: To ask for and give a brief description of different climates. Matching words and images. To recognise and interpret the symbols and elements shown on a map. The importance of expanding the knowledge previously acquired in the other Language. Contents ? Conceptual Knowledge (declarative): The captions of the Climate map: TROPICAL: high temperature, regular rainy season. DRY: low rainfall, high temperatures during the day. WARM: temperate climates such as ours with 4 seasons. The other 3 cold: altitude (mountains) and closeness to the poles means lower temperatures. Procedural: To interpret the captions on a map and its symbols correctly. To differentiate these elements on the map. Describe each of these elements briefly. Attitude: To develop interest and curiosity for learning knowledge already acquired about the earth in English. Recognising and evaluating the importance of knowing how to read and write a foreign language. Listening carefully to pronunciation of all the words. Prior knowledge: Knowledge of English from the second stage. Knowledge previously acquired about the earth and its weather in the first language. Access the learning guide for the object.
